    What is Virtual Reality Learning Media?

    Alright, so what exactly is virtual reality learning media? Simply put, it's using VR technology to create immersive, interactive, and simulated learning environments. Instead of just reading about the Amazon rainforest, you can virtually step into it! Imagine exploring ancient Rome without leaving your classroom or dissecting a virtual heart without any of the mess. That's the power of VR learning, folks! The integration of VR into education is more than just a technological novelty; it represents a paradigm shift in how knowledge is imparted and acquired. Traditional teaching methods often rely on passive learning, where students absorb information through lectures and textbooks. VR, however, flips this model on its head by placing students in active, experiential learning scenarios. This active engagement fosters a deeper understanding and retention of the material, as learners are not just memorizing facts but experiencing them firsthand. Moreover, VR learning media transcends the limitations of physical classrooms. Students can access environments and experiences that would otherwise be impossible or impractical to replicate in a traditional setting. For instance, a medical student can perform a complex surgery in a risk-free virtual environment, honing their skills and building confidence before entering a real operating room. Similarly, history students can walk through the streets of ancient civilizations, gaining a visceral understanding of the past that no textbook could ever provide. The immersive nature of VR also caters to diverse learning styles. Visual learners benefit from the rich, detailed graphics and spatial representations, while kinesthetic learners thrive in the interactive, hands-on environment. This inclusivity ensures that all students, regardless of their learning preferences, can engage with the material in a way that resonates with them. Furthermore, VR learning media offers personalized learning experiences tailored to individual student needs. Adaptive VR programs can adjust the difficulty level and pace of learning based on a student's performance, providing targeted support and challenges. This individualized approach maximizes learning outcomes and ensures that each student reaches their full potential. In essence, virtual reality learning media is not just about using technology to enhance education; it's about transforming the entire learning process into a more engaging, effective, and personalized experience.

    Benefits of VR in Education

    So, why should we be excited about VR in education? The benefits are HUGE! First off, engagement goes through the roof. Let's be real, staring at a textbook can be a snoozefest. But exploring a virtual world? That's something students will actually look forward to. VR also boosts knowledge retention. When you're actively involved in an experience, you're more likely to remember it. Plus, VR offers unparalleled accessibility. Students can visit places and experience things that would otherwise be impossible due to geographical, financial, or physical limitations. Think about the students who might never get to travel to Egypt. With VR, they can explore the pyramids as if they were really there! Another significant advantage of VR in education is its ability to create safe learning environments. In fields like medicine or engineering, mistakes can have serious consequences. VR allows students to practice complex procedures and experiment with different scenarios without any real-world risks. This fosters a culture of experimentation and learning from mistakes, which is crucial for developing skilled professionals. Furthermore, VR can enhance collaboration and teamwork. Students can participate in virtual group projects, working together to solve problems and complete tasks in a shared virtual environment. This promotes communication, cooperation, and critical thinking skills, which are essential for success in the modern workplace. The immersive nature of VR also helps to bridge cultural and social divides. Students from different backgrounds can come together in a virtual space to learn about each other's cultures and perspectives. This fosters empathy, understanding, and a sense of global citizenship. In addition to these benefits, VR can also provide valuable data and insights into student learning. By tracking student interactions and performance in VR environments, educators can gain a better understanding of their learning processes and identify areas where they may need additional support. This data-driven approach allows for more personalized and effective instruction. Ultimately, the benefits of VR in education extend far beyond just making learning more fun and engaging. It has the potential to transform the way we teach and learn, creating more effective, accessible, and equitable educational opportunities for all students.

    Examples of VR Applications in Education

    Okay, let's get into some real-world examples! Medical students can use VR to perform virtual surgeries, practicing complex procedures in a safe and controlled environment. History classes can transport students back in time to experience historical events firsthand. Imagine walking through the streets of ancient Rome or witnessing the signing of the Declaration of Independence! Science students can explore the human body in amazing detail or even travel to outer space. The possibilities are truly endless. Here are some more specific examples: VR field trips to museums and historical sites, interactive language learning experiences where students can practice speaking with virtual characters, engineering simulations where students can design and test structures, and virtual art studios where students can create and display their artwork. These examples demonstrate the versatility of VR in education and its ability to enhance learning across a wide range of subjects. Moreover, VR applications in education are constantly evolving and becoming more sophisticated. Developers are creating new and innovative ways to use VR to enhance learning, such as incorporating artificial intelligence (AI) to provide personalized feedback and guidance to students. AI-powered VR tutors can adapt to each student's learning style and pace, providing targeted support and challenges to help them master the material. In addition to AI, augmented reality (AR) is also being integrated with VR to create even more immersive and interactive learning experiences. AR overlays digital information onto the real world, allowing students to interact with virtual objects and environments in their own physical space. For example, students could use an AR app to dissect a virtual frog on their desk or explore a 3D model of the solar system in their living room. The combination of VR and AR has the potential to revolutionize education, creating learning experiences that are both engaging and highly effective. As VR technology becomes more affordable and accessible, we can expect to see even more innovative applications in education. The future of learning is immersive, interactive, and personalized, and VR is playing a key role in shaping that future.

    Challenges and Considerations

    Now, it's not all sunshine and rainbows. There are some challenges to consider when implementing VR in education. Cost can be a barrier, as VR headsets and software can be expensive. There's also the issue of technical support and training for teachers. Not everyone is tech-savvy, and it takes time and effort to learn how to use VR effectively in the classroom. Motion sickness can be a problem for some users, and there are concerns about the potential for eye strain and other health issues. Access to reliable internet connectivity is also crucial, as many VR applications require a stable internet connection. Overcoming these challenges requires careful planning, investment in infrastructure and training, and a commitment to addressing the potential health and safety concerns. Schools and educational institutions need to develop comprehensive VR implementation plans that take into account the cost, technical requirements, and potential health risks. It's also important to provide ongoing professional development for teachers to ensure that they are equipped with the skills and knowledge to use VR effectively in the classroom. Furthermore, it's essential to address the digital divide and ensure that all students have access to VR technology, regardless of their socioeconomic background. This may require providing VR headsets and internet access to students from low-income families. In addition to these practical considerations, there are also ethical issues to consider when using VR in education. It's important to ensure that VR experiences are designed in a way that is inclusive and respectful of all cultures and backgrounds. VR should not be used to perpetuate stereotypes or promote harmful ideologies. It's also important to protect student privacy and ensure that their data is not being collected or used without their consent. Addressing these ethical considerations requires careful thought and planning. Educators and developers need to work together to create VR experiences that are both engaging and ethically sound. By addressing these challenges and considerations proactively, we can ensure that VR is used in a way that benefits all students and promotes a more equitable and inclusive education system.
